
A Proactive Approach to Operations
A large food production and manufacturing company operating in regional NSW engaged MOVUS as part of a broader leadership initiative to improve operational maturity across its site.
Rather than responding to a failure or incident, the focus was proactive. The team was looking for greater visibility into asset health, increased confidence in maintenance decisions, and a more structured approach to managing operational risk, without adding the complexity to day-to-day operations. As part of this approach, the team prioritised the After Cooler Blower Motor which plays a critical role in maintaining stable downstream processing conditions. While not always the most visible asset on site, its reliability directly affects product quality and unplanned downtime risk.
In many operations, assets like this are maintained on fixed schedules or checked reactively. Subtle degradation can go unnoticed until it escalates into disruption.
What MOVUS Detected
Shortly after the deployment of FitMachine sensors on the After Cooler Blower Motor, PlantOS identified a clear change in vibration behaviour of the motor drive-end bearing, despite no previously reported issues from operations or maintenance teams. The data showed a rapid increase in overall vibration over a short period, consistent with lubrication degradation.
These patterns indicated early-stage bearing distress, detected well before functional failure or any impact on production.
The Operational Outcome
With early insight into the developing issue, the site team was able to act decisively an at the right time. Maintenance was planned and carried out during normal operations, with a simple corrective action: bearing lubrication. There was no need for an emergency response, no disruption to production, and no secondary damage to the asset.
